The Montgomery County Economic Development Corporation (MCEDC) serves as the official economic development entity for Montgomery County, Maryland to accelerate business development, attraction, retention and expansion in key industry sectors while advancing equitable and inclusive economic growth.

Montgomery County Economic Development Corporation operates as a 501(c)(3) nonprofit public-private partnership and is funded by Montgomery County. They are dedicated to attracting, retaining and expanding businesses within key industries to Montgomery County, Md.

The vision is to drive effective economic prosperity initiatives that foster job growth, and to cultivate a business ecosystem conducive to a vibrant and competitive local economy.
